Baller andjules Posted February 9, 2017 Baller Share Posted February 9, 2017 There's a lot to like about the Gulf Coast these days, but from Naples to St Petersburg, there's really only one ski site (Eden; or drive well east of Tampa to McCormick's... correct me if I'm wrong). For comparison, from Miami to West Palm, there are 2-3 pay-to-ski sites (McGinnis, Chet's) plus a few clubs (Miami, Okeeheelee) where it wouldn't be hard to get some rides if you make some connections on this site. On the other hand, if you like road trips, you could start in West Palm, head down and across Alligator Alley, and up the Gulf Coast.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Baller_ lpskier Posted March 29, 2017 Baller_ Share Posted March 29, 2017 Duvall's at Disney is not like ski school. It's more like family activity skiing. If you want to ski, there are several sites near Disney that are probably more in line with your skiing expectations, such as Drew Ross, TGas, Jody Fisher, Matt Rini, Wade Cox at OWC, Lucky Lowe's and LaPoints. All of these sites are within 20 minutes of the Disney property. I'm sure any of the sites would enjoy having you, but for sure we'd be happy to host you at LaPoints, where you can either take lessons ($60) or ski rides ($30), or both.
